1. A device for detecting response characteristics of a sensor applied to an air-fuel ratio control system that controls by feedback the amount of the fuel fed into an internal combustion engine based on an output of a sensor that detects the air-fuel ratio or the oxygen concentration of the exhaust gas emitted from the internal combustion engine, comprising:

  • fuel changing timing determining means for determining a timing at which the amount of the fuel fed into the internal combustion engine changes; and

    step response characteristics detecting means which monitors the behavior of the sensor output before and after the change in the amount of feeding the fuel, and detects the response characteristics of the sensor in a manner of being divided into the dead time from a moment when the amount of feeding the fuel is changed until the sensor output starts changing and the subsequent n-order delay characteristics (n is a positive integer) representing a change in the sensor output.
